WebMay 30, 2024 · The sunken city of Cuba refers to a series of symmetrical formations found on the sea floor off the coast of Cuba in 2001. It became the subject of intense debate over whether the structures are man made or simply the result of Mother Nature. Despite. WebJan 5, 2024 · The discovery of the deep-sea city of Cuba was made almost twenty years ago, but media and public interest in it has since faded. Research has come to a standstill, and without more data, the answers remain uncertain. However, the initial sonar images of the "lost city" did have a significant impact on the Cuban government and its citizens.
